#xwzx ul li {
	float: none;
}

.fontdiv {
	font-size: 16px;
}

a.new_nva:link, a.new_nva:visited {
	font-size: 16px;
	font-weight: normal;
	color: #000;
	text-decoration: none;
}

a.new_nva:hover, a.new_nva:active {
	font-size: 16px;
	font-weight: normal;
	color: #DA512D;
	text-decoration: none;
}

a.new_red:link, a.new_red:visited {
	font-size: 14px;
	font-weight: normal;
	color: #DA4E2B;
	text-decoration: none;
}

a.new_red:hover, a.new_red:active {
	font-size: 14px;
	font-weight: normal;
	color: #3ACDFF;
	text-decoration: none;
}
/* 顶部 */
#webSiteTop {
	background-image: url("../images/bg1.jpg");
}

#indexback {
	background-image: url("../images/index_02.jpg");
	background-repeat: repeat;
	min-width: 0px;
}

.header-top {
	height: 30px;
	line-height: 30px;
	font-size: 12px;
}

.header-top font span {
	margin-left: 5px;
	margin-right: 5px;
	font-size: 14px;
}

.header-top>ul {
	font-size: 12px;
}

.header-top>ul>li {
	margin-left: 10px;
	height: 30px;
	line-height: 30px;
}

.header-top .splitLine {
	height: 15px;
	margin-top: 7.5px;
}

.splitLine {
	border-left: 1px solid #DADADA;
	border-right: 1px solid #FFFFFF;
}

#loginName {
	margin-right: 10px;
}

/*即时下拉样式*/
.immediately div {
	display: block;
	margin: 0px;
	margin-top: 5px;
	padding: 5px;
	text-indent: 7px;
	cursor: pointer;
}

.immediately div:hover {
	background-color: #F0F0F0;
}

.immediately {
	text-align: left;
	border: 1px solid #E5E5E5;
	border-top: none;
	background-color: white;
	line-height: normal;
}

/* 头部 */
.header-ul {
	margin-bottom: 15px;
	height: 12px;
	line-height: 12px;
}

.header-ul ul {
	float: right;
	height: inherit;
}

.header-ul li {
	margin-right: 10px;
	height: inherit;
}

.header-ul a {
	font-size: 12px;
}

.qfw-header {
	max-width: 1200px;
	margin: auto;
	line-height: 80px;
}

.qfw-header_entlist {
	padding: 20px 15px 0px 13px;
}

.header_logo {
	width: 161px;
	height: 68px;
}

.header_line {
	margin-left: 5px;
	margin-right: 5px;
}

.qfw-header font {
	vertical-align: middle;
	font-weight: bold;
	font-size: 30px;
	color: #999;
}
/* 中间 */
.qfw-content {
	padding: 30px 40px;
}
/* 底部 */
.qfw-bottom {
	background: url("../images/bottom_bg_new.jpg");
	font-size: 12px;
	height: 120px;
	padding: 0px;
}

.bottom-header {
	margin-top: -1px;
	height: 10px;
	width: 100%;
	background: url("../images/bottom_header.png");
}

.qfw-bottom>div {
	display: inline-block;
	font-size:14px;
}

.qfw-bottom img {
	vertical-align: text-bottom;
	margin-top: 26px;
	width: 50px;
	height: 52px;
}

.qfw-bottom-text span {
	color: #FFFFFF;
}

.qfw-bottom-text a {
	margin-left: 8px;
	margin-right: 8px;
	color: white;
}

.qfw-bottom-text a:hover, .qfw-bottom-text a:focus {
	color: #97310e;
}

.qfw-bottom-text>div {
	margin-top: 10px;
	color: white;
}

.bottom-bar {
	width: 42px;
	position: fixed;
	bottom: 5px;
	display: none;
}

.bottom-bar img {
	width: 40px;
	height: 40px;
}

.bottom-bar li {
	width: 100%;
	margin-bottom: 0px;
	cursor: pointer;
	margin-top: 5px;
}
/* 第三方登录图标 */
.weixinLoginBtn, .qqLoginBtn {
	width: 26px;
	height: 26px;
	margin-right: 10px;
	cursor: pointer;
}
/*==========以下部分是Validform必须的===========*/
.Validform_checktip {
	color: #3a87ad;
	background-image: url('../images/info_bg.png');
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='/images/info_bg.png',
		sizingMethod='scale') \9;
}

.Validform_wrong {
	color: #97310e;
	background-image: url('../images/error_bg.png');
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='/images/error_bg.png',
		sizingMethod='scale') \9;
}

.Validform_checktip, .Validform_wrong {
	padding: 11px 20px;
	display: none;
	line-height: 38px;
	height: 38px;
	white-space: nowrap;
	background-size: 100% 100%;
	-moz-background-size: 100% 100%;
	-o-background-size: 100% 100%;
	-webkit-background-size: 100% 100%;
	background-repeat: no-repeat;
}

.Validform_loading {
	background: none !important;
}

.Validform_right {
	background: url('../images/right.png') center no-repeat;
	width: 32px !important;
	height: 38px;
}
/* ----------系统设置----------- */
#Ttd {
	font-size: 12px;
	border: 0px;
	border-top: 1px dashed #333333;
	line-height: 30px;
}

.sli {
	float: none;
	background-color: #EFFEFF;
	border-bottom: none;
}

.dropdown-menu li {
	float: none;
}
/*==========表单中验证码样式===========*/
.afterSendIdentCode {
	font-size: 12px;
	display: none;
}

.sendIdentCodeBtn.text-muted {
	cursor: auto !important;
}

.sendIdentCodeBtn {
	width: 112px;
	cursor: pointer;
	font-size: 13px;
}

.checkCodeId {
	float: left !important;
	padding-right: 15px !important;
}

.checkCodeId .input-group-addon {
	padding: 0px 5px;
	font-size: 12px;
	line-height: 36px;
}

.checkCodeId .input-group-addon img {
	margin-right: 5px;
	width: 80px;
	height: 30px;
}

.checkCodeId .input-group-addon a {
	text-decoration: underline;
}
/* --------------------------步骤选择样式-------------------------- */
.witchStep {
	display: block;
	margin: 15px 0px 15px 15px;
	height: 50px;
}

.witchStep li {
	text-align: center;
	height: 40px;
	line-height: 40px;
	background-position: center;
	background-repeat: no-repeat;
	margin-right: 10px;
	font-weight: bold;
}

.li_active_b {
	background-image: url("/images/grayRound.png") !important;
}

.li_active_a {
	background-image: url("/images/redLine.png") !important;
}

.step_last {
	margin-top: 100px;
}

.step_last img {
	margin-right: 10px;
	width: 45px;
	height: 45px;
}

.step_last span {
	vertical-align: middle;
}

.step_last a {
	margin-left: 20px;
}
/*==========用户中心中间布局样式===========*/
.member-content:after{
	content: " ";
	clear: both;
	display: table;
}
.member-content {
	margin-bottom: 30px;
}

.member-left, .member-right {
	vertical-align: top;
	display: inline-block;
}

.member-left {
	color: #666;
    width: 250px;
	border: 1px solid #E5E6E9;
	background-color: #fff;
}

.member-right {
	width: 940px;
	float: right;
}
/*==========账号信息设置表单标题样式===========*/
.member-panel {
	min-height: 400px;
}

.member-panel form {
	margin-top: 20px;
	margin-left: 20px;
}

.member-panel-middle {
	height: 400px;
	line-height: 400px;
}

.member-prompt {
	padding: 0px 10px;
	margin-bottom: 10px;
	height: 30px;
	line-height: 30px;
	background-color: #FFEB8C;
	border-radius: 4px;
}

.member-prompt .member-prompt-remove {
	float: right;
	font-size: 20px
}
/*==========会员中心首页区块元素的标题===========*/
.panel-title-in, .panel-title-out {
	margin-bottom: 10px;
	padding-left: 10px;
}

.panel-title-in i, .panel-title-out i {
	font-size: 20px;
	color: #ff5a5f;
	vertical-align: sub;
	margin-right: 10px;
}

.panel-title-in span, .panel-title-out span {
	font-weight: bold;
	font-size: 16px;
	color: #666;
}

.panel-title-out .pull-right i {
	font-size: 16px;
}
/*==========点击邀请链接之后跳转到页面的样式===========*/
.invite-form-title {
	height: 60px;
	line-height: 60px;
	padding-left: 30px;
	font-size: 30px;
	text-align: left;
	margin-top: 0px;
	margin-bottom: 30px;
	font-weight: 400;
	font-size: 24px;
	background-color: #F7F7F7;
	border-bottom: 1px solid #ddd;
	overflow: hidden;
	text-overflow: ellipsis;
	white-space: nowrap;
}

.invite-form-title font {
	font-weight: 700;
	font-size: 22px;
}
/************div模拟表格布局**************/
.tablediv {
	display: table;
	border-collapse: separate;
}

.rowcontent {
	display: table-row;
}

.rowcontent div {
	display: table-cell;
}

/*==========覆盖bootstrap样式 start===========*/
.bootstrap-glyphicon {
	font-family: 'Glyphicons Halflings' !important;
}
[class*="col-"] {
	padding-left: 0px !important;
}
.btn{
	padding-top: 6px;
	padding-bottom: 6px;
}
.btn-primary,.btn-primary:hover,.btn-primary:focus,.btn-primary:active{
	background-color: #FF5A5F;
	border-color: #FF5A5F;
}
.btn-default,.btn-default:hover,.btn-default:focus,.btn-default:active{
	background-color: transparent;
	border: 1px solid #FF5A5F;
	color: #FF5A5F;
	box-shadow: none;
}
.btn.disabled, .btn.disabled.active, .btn.disabled.focus, .btn.disabled:active, .btn.disabled:focus, .btn.disabled:hover, .btn[disabled], .btn[disabled].active, .btn[disabled].focus, .btn[disabled]:active, .btn[disabled]:focus, .btn[disabled]:hover, fieldset[disabled] .btn, fieldset[disabled] .btn.active, fieldset[disabled] .btn.focus, fieldset[disabled] .btn:active, fieldset[disabled] .btn:focus, fieldset[disabled] .btn:hover{
	color: #FFFFFF;
	background-color: #aea79f;
	border-color: #aea79f;
}
.btn-sm, .btn-group-sm > .btn{
	padding-top: 3px;
	padding-bottom: 3px;
}
.btn-xs, .btn-group-xs > .btn{
	padding-top: 0px;
	padding-bottom: 0px;
}
.text-primary {
	color: #FF5A5F !important;
}
.modal-content{
	border-radius: 4px;
	border-top-left-radius: 5px;
	border-top-right-radius: 5px;
}
.modal-header{
	border-top-left-radius: 4px;
	border-top-right-radius: 4px;
}
.form-control{
	border-radius: 0px;
}
/*==========覆盖bootstrap样式 end===========*/
.lineb {
	display: inline-block;
}

.fontb {
	font-weight: bold;
}

.marginTop {
	margin-top: 20px;
}

.marginLeft {
	margin-left: 50px;
}

.border {
	border: 1px solid #ddd;
}

.borderT {
	border-top: 1px solid #ddd;
}

.borderB {
	border-bottom: 1px solid #ddd;
}

.frontS {
	font-size: 16px;
}

span.highlight {
	/*color:#D5012C;*/
	color: #dd4814;
	font-weight: bold;
}